**Ticket: Cron drift on Hallowmere batch host**

For security review. The nightly cron set on the Hallowmere batch host no longer matches the manifest in the Corbel config repo. Two jobs run fifteen minutes earlier than declared, and one retired purge job is still active. No evidence of tampering yet, but the drift predates our last audit, so provenance is unclear. Requesting sign-off before we reconcile, since the purge job touches retention-scoped data. The manifest's expected configuration is reproduced below.

config for yajep-tafof:
[rusath]
team = julmir
access_code = ac_fe37fd
host = rusath.novactech.test
port = 8000
owner = pelmir.weneth
peer = oliwyn.olvarqdyn.internal

Ticket #842 — DiffBarge env mixup. Heads up for whoever touches this next: the large-file diff viewer was pointed at the staging chunk store, so 2GB diffs were timing out constantly. Fixed by swapping the endpoint in .env.production. While you're in there, make sure the chunk-store token line reads exactly as follows.

secret setting of kawip-tajop: RELAY_SECRET8=11ecb20c

Management Meeting Minutes — Hedging Decision

Present: department heads, Treasury. Chair: R. Annesley.

Agreed: hedge 65% of florin exposure via quarterly forwards; Treasury to execute within ten days. Rejected options-based approach on cost grounds. Vossmark counterparty list approved. Review set for next quarter's meeting. All heads to flag material FX commitments weekly. Strategic context is noted below.

board note of kagep-yahig: Only 9 of the 120 pilot accounts renewed Quenix, so a churn review is set for April 1.